Predicting Visual Consciousness Electrophysiologically from Intermittent Binocular Rivalry

PURPOSE: We sought brain activity that predicts visual consciousness. METHODS: We used electroencephalography (EEG) to measure brain activity to a 1000-ms display of sine-wave gratings, oriented vertically in one eye and horizontally in the other.
